Septic suitability in Kiowa County, CO
Very limited
Kiowa County, CO's SSURGO dominant class comes back "Very limited", covering 51.3% of the county. A standard gravity system routinely fails on ground like this; the same share of the county falls in USDA's worst absorption-field bucket outright. The county spans 1,767.809 square miles, home to 1,392 people.
What this number does and doesn't tell you
USDA's survey covers the whole of Kiowa County, CO at once, not any single address. Budget $750-$1,850 for a real perc test on any specific parcel - that's the only figure a permit application accepts.
Kiowa County: conventional vs. engineered cost
51.3% of Kiowa County carrying a "Very limited" reading changes the realistic budget here. Conventional systems run $3,000-$8,000 where they pass; where they don't, engineered alternatives (mound or aerobic treatment, whichever the health department requires) run $10,000-$40,000 - budget toward the higher figure until a perc test says otherwise.
